Output 66aa58a3756df59bb200cf97e7ecd6e07e5c9991e910bf307ec43b7f76eebec6:1

value
10093904141
script pubkey
OP_0 OP_PUSHBYTES_20 ce49dba817f43e97146e51a8b8fce5eb858e6bff
address
ltc1qeeyah2qh7slfw9rw2x5t3l89awzcu6lljcf8kp
transaction
66aa58a3756df59bb200cf97e7ecd6e07e5c9991e910bf307ec43b7f76eebec6
spent
true